Too-tall trucks hit bridges a dozen times in 2006: DOT

  • The state has started looking at eliminating bridges with low vertical clearances.
  • By BENJAMIN MINNICK
    Journal Construction Editor

    Photo courtesy of WSDOT [enlarge]
    A southbound truck yesterday hit the 178th Street bridge over I-5, damaging a girder.

    A truck hit the South 178th Street overpass yesterday, tying up traffic on southbound Interstate 5 near Southcenter mall for several miles and causing significant damage to the bridge.
